Skip to main content

Parsl-based plugin for lsst-ctrl-bps.

Project description

ctrl_bps_parsl

pypi codecov

This package is a Parsl-based plugin for the LSST Batch Production Service (BPS) execution framework. It is intended to support running LSST PipelineTask jobs on high-performance computing (HPC) clusters. Parsl includes execution providers that allow operation on batch systems typically used by HPC clusters, e.g., Slurm, PBS/Torque and LSF. Parsl can also be configured to run on a single node using a thread pool, which is useful for testing and development.

This is a Python 3 only package (we assume Python 3.8 or higher).

Documentation will be available here.

This software is dual licensed under the GNU General Public License (version 3 of the License, or (at your option) any later version, and also under a 3-clause BSD license. Recipients may choose which of these licenses to use; please see the files gpl-3.0.txt and/or bsd_license.txt, respectively.

Project details


Release history Release notifications | RSS feed

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distribution

lsst-ctrl-bps-parsl-26.2023.5000.tar.gz (35.1 kB view details)

Uploaded Source

Built Distribution

If you're not sure about the file name format, learn more about wheel file names.

lsst_ctrl_bps_parsl-26.2023.5000-py3-none-any.whl (48.7 kB view details)

Uploaded Python 3

File details

Details for the file lsst-ctrl-bps-parsl-26.2023.5000.tar.gz.

File metadata

File hashes

Hashes for lsst-ctrl-bps-parsl-26.2023.5000.tar.gz
Algorithm Hash digest
SHA256 6382e1bab3a9b0d277d7631eb4d8eb80beda05eb2db008a58107445ab72f1db5
MD5 f00785137e296065b24334b526862ab3
BLAKE2b-256 6adcb6a4888d971ded1fccb6fb0201a043db9666a98840167ee585c0b6cd12c9

See more details on using hashes here.

File details

Details for the file lsst_ctrl_bps_parsl-26.2023.5000-py3-none-any.whl.

File metadata

File hashes

Hashes for lsst_ctrl_bps_parsl-26.2023.5000-py3-none-any.whl
Algorithm Hash digest
SHA256 809cc03dea2baacc251906f73664607ed15c03e1d146bc5df394407164dfe36a
MD5 006cc21d44282d375a32d74b25b79f30
BLAKE2b-256 2d470940b8f5f64c26ce80ef480ea96145e61d6db9dd55f997f9c80281a65872

See more details on using hashes here.

Supported by

AWS Cloud computing and Security Sponsor Datadog Monitoring Depot Continuous Integration Fastly CDN Google Download Analytics Pingdom Monitoring Sentry Error logging StatusPage Status page